Keck Graduate Institute offers admissions for international students in rolling basis. International students must meet all the entry-level requirements at KGI. International students can apply at Keck Graduate Institute through University Official Portal. International students applying at KGI must have a minimum GPA of 3.0 or higher to secure admission at the university. International students must submit all the essential documents along with their admission application.

The Keck Graduate Institute does not consider GPA as a primary element during admission. However, some programs like master's of Physician Assistant Studies programs require a minimum GPA of 3 or above as a basic admission eligibility. Along with GPA scores, students must meet the basic eligibility including a bachelor's degree from an accredited university or its equivalent. They also need to turn in the necessary paperwork, which includes unofficial transcripts or equivalent, resume, letter of recommendation, program-specific requirements, English language proficiency, and more.

Leiden University expects minimum GPA of 3.2 on 4 point scale from international students. Along with GPA score, students must take care of various factors while deciding to enter the university. They must have completed 2 years of university studies and have relevant experience in course they are applying for. Students must show their English language requirements by submitting the scores of IELTS and TOEFL.

Columbus State University offers admissions for international students in three semesters such as Fall, Spring, and Summer semesters. International students must meet all the entry-level requirements at CSU. International students can apply at Columbus State University through University Official Portal for both UG and PG programs. International students applying at CSU must have a minimum GPA of 2.5 or above to secure admission at the university. International students must submit all the essential documents along with their admission application.

The University of California, Santa Cruz, is one of the most demanding universities when it comes to the minimum GPA requirements for admission. For international students, a GPA of 3.4 or above out of 4.0 is recommended for admission. Along with GPA, applicants must also focus on other admission requirements like meeting the English language requirements for UG and PG, and submission of mandatory documents like academic records, updated CV/resume, ACT / SAT / GMAT / GRE test scores (if required), as per the requirements of the programs.

Felician University provides 4 year UG degree course in Nursing. The minimum eligibility requirements include GPA, high school transcripts, ACT/ SAT scores, letter of recommendation, and personal statements. A student with a 3.7 GPA can easily get into the Nursing course as the minimum GPA requirement for the course is 3.2 on a scale of 4.
